Output e8f73528a4b63e8e8e02ced9d6fc43bb229d564f6cc7888dbf3656e2d2636010:115

value
183279
script pubkey
OP_0 OP_PUSHBYTES_20 efe1f65fb566e51c754b88f964093cf5086e756c
address
bc1qalslvha4vmj3ca2t3rukgzfu75yxuatv3ynnrm
transaction
e8f73528a4b63e8e8e02ced9d6fc43bb229d564f6cc7888dbf3656e2d2636010
confirmations
18099
spent
true